TABLE 4

Support for linkage to variation in CC-GFR* in different groups of relatives

ChromosomeClosest markerLocation (cM)Max. LOD score§Nominal PEmpirical PLOD-1 interval (Mb)
Diabetic relative pairs       
    2q D2S1384 202 4.1 6.2 × 10−6 2 × 10−5 195–213 
    10q D10S2470–D10S677 114 3.6 2.5 × 10−5 1.2 × 10−4 85–101 
    18p D18S843 28 2.2 7.0 × 10−4 2.4 × 10−3 6–10 
Nondiabetic relative pairs       
    3q D3S1744 161 2.2 6.6 × 10−4 1.2 × 10−3 138–152 
    11p D11S1993 52 2.1 8.0 × 10−4 1.6 × 10−3 36–53 
All relative pairs       
    7p D7S3047–D7S3051 23 4.0 9.8 × 10−6 4 × 10−5 6–26
